MEN v WOMEN
Wed 19th June 24

Well this was an historic night in more ways than one! With the Euro`s on and Scotland playing Switzerland, needing at least a draw to give themselves a change to reach the knockout stage, it was an electric night! 

The Scotland match was the main attraction and reduced the numbers at the Men v Women which ran in the back ground, but for those that did make the effort, thank you and what a battle in the end on and off the pitch/boards!

After the women's historic victory last season, could they do the impossible and make it back to back wins for the first time ever?

Last year they won by 15 chalks, this time around it was a much closer affair, with only two chalks in it, but none the less, history was made, and it was congratulations to the women winning 95-93 on the night!

Well played to the women and their captain, Alice Noble, for making history!

How things have changed, and instead of, "will the women get a win for a change", it`s "Will the men ever get their hands on the trophy again"!

A Scotland fighting draw and a women`s victory, made it a night to remember at the Taxi Club!

Thank you to the Taxi Club for hosting the event, and the Bar staff for their hard work on the night.

Most of all, thank you to the players and teams (Club Metro; Ellenbank: Hobo`s; Rat Pack; Rosebank 80; Tams Bar; Taxi Club & Victoria), that made the effort to turn-up and play during a Scotland match!

Once again, congratulations to the women and their captain, Alice Noble, bragging rights the women!

Can the women make it 3 in a row next year? We will just need to wait and see!

MEN v WOMEN
Wed 14th June 23

What an epic night of dominoes in the Taxi Club with the Men versus Women cup competition.

Before the night started, there was a bit of worry that this event would not be supported as well, as it was no longer a league event. Glad to report that was not the case, indeed, we had one of the best turnouts ever!

In all we had 32 men and 24 women, which meant the top 8 women would play a second games. All matches were the best of 13 chalks, 1st to 7 wins!

The women got off to a flying start winning 4 of the first 5 matches, and by big margins to take an early lead 32 – 18 (14 chalk lead)!

Unbelievably the women then won 4 of the next 5 singles again to increase their lead to 21 chalks (65 – 44)!

In the third set of 5 matches the men hit back, winning 4 of them to close the gap to just 10 chalks (87 – 77)!

The 4th set of 5 matches saw the men win 3 of the 5 matches to close the gap to just 4 chalks (112 – 108)!

Incredibly, the men won 4 of the next 5 matches to take the lead for the first time by 4 chalks (139 – 135). What a fight back by the men!

But the women did not buckle and in the next 5 games all the winning female players came back on and just carried on where they left off by absolutely trouncing the male players winning all 5 matches, two of them by 7 – 1 to completely turn things around and stick a dagger in the men’s hearts to lead by 16 chalks (170 – 154) with only two matches left!

This time the impossible was impossible even if the men could have won the last two matches 7 – 0! Of course that did not happen anyway and the final score was;

Men 167, Women 182

Victory and the bragging rights go to the women’s team who win by an amazing 15 chalks. What a last 7 matches by the ladies after the men had caught them up, outstanding performance and the first time in 8 years since they last beat the men!

The double winners for the ladies were; Captain, Alice Noble, Ann Shepherd, Sharon Rourke, Audrey Smith, Pat Mitchell & Loraine Abbot

Congratulations and well deserved ladies!

Thank you to the Taxi Club and James Hendry for hosting the Men v Women competition and a fantastic night was had by all, especially for the ladies who partied all night long!

MEN v WOMEN 2021-22

Oh what a night as the last league event took place. The Men v Women brought the curtain down on the 2021-22 season with only the Dance and Trophy Presentations to take place (Sat 13th Aug 22).


This match took place on Wednesday 25th May 2022, 7:45pm in the Taxi Club. The men had 30 players, while the women had 21 players with 9 of their players playing twice.

In all 30 individual matches took place with the men winning 17 of them and the women winning 13. On the women's side Ann Shepherd (Victoria), Ann Rigden (Blackwatch) & Jackie Gallacher (Ladywell) won both their matches against the men so big thumbs up!

There were a few close 9-8 matches; The biggest margin was 9-2 when John McLaughlan (Taxi Club) beat Denise Hendry (Club Metro). (Sorry Denise). But Denise did win her second match!

Club Metro had 9 players, with Hobo`s 8 players. Four teams had no players, with one team only having one. They will be fined. (see spreadsheet for more info). 

It was a good fun nights dominoes but there has to be a winner and once again it`s congratulations to the men who won 233 - 206! Commiserations to the women this time. There is always next year!
